Kiski Area School Board approves amended high-school track contract totaling $649,825 potential maximum
Summary
The Kiski Area School District board approved an amended contract to install a new red track at the high school, awarding Asphalt Surface Enterprises $527,825 plus a $32,000 allowance for a javelin runway and up to $90,000 for cement stabilization; installation is set to begin Aug. 23, 2025, pending solicitor review.
The Kiski Area School District Board of School Directors on Aug. 18 approved an amended contract to install a red synthetic track at the high school, awarding the work to Asphalt Surface Enterprises for $527,825 and approving a separate $32,000 allowance for a javelin runway and up to $90,000 for cement stabilization.
